Getting from Belfast International Airport (BFS) to central Belfast
The centre of Belfast is roughly 19 kilometres from Belfast International Airport. Journey times by cab or car hire will vary based on time of day, so do some research ahead of your trip.
It takes around 2 hours if you're travelling on public transport.

The best time to fly from Rome to Belfast International Airport (BFS)
It's time to figure out your travel dates for your flight from Rome to Belfast International Airport (BFS). August is when most people travel to Belfast. If you like your getaways a little more chill, go in February.
Book a Rome to BFS plane ticket departing in July if you want to explore the city during its warmest month. You can expect temperatures in Belfast to range from 10ºC (50ºF) to 19ºC (66ºF).
If you like cooler conditions, look for a cheap ticket from Rome to Belfast International Airport in January when temperatures are between 1ºC (34ºF) and 8ºC (46ºF).
